Writing and Managing a Business Blog Post – The Must Knows

By Lloyd Silver

Are you interested in blogging? Of course you are, or you wouldn’t have clicked on this blog post! In this post I will go over how to not only write a blog post, but the steps you should take after you write it.

Blogs have become essential for the 21st century website. There are tons of benefits to blogging; they give information to prospective and current customers, they give you an opportunity to get your website linked on the web, and it helps your website get ranked higher on search rankings.

Writing blogs to your potential and current customers is a great opportunity to try to provide them with information that helps them understand what your business offers. Blogs are great opportunities to try and sell a product or service that your company provides. You can write about anything and everything as long as it pertains to your business or the products or services that you provide because that is where your authority stands. There are many different types of posts you can do too. You can write an update or review, you can give advice, you can create a checklist, or even generate an infographic. When it comes to blogging the possibilities are endless.

By posting a blog you add pages to your website which is great for SEO and search ranking purposes. You can take these links and publish them to social media, thus making more links to your website. By creating more links to your website you are creating what are called “citations” in SEO; this helps make your site more visible. Along with citations most search engines rank your website based off of the amount of fresh content. This means the more you post to your website the more likely your website will be ranked higher on the search listings.

Managing a business blog can be troublesome sometimes and it can be hard to find time to write. That’s why it’s always a good idea to create a specialized calendar to help you keep track of what topics to cover and when to cover them.
